hyperactive

US /ˌhaɪ.pɚˈæk.tɪv/
UK /ˌhaɪ.pərˈæk.tɪv/

Adjective

Someone who is hyperactive has more energy than is normal, gets excited easily, and cannot stay still or think about work:

Example:
Hyperactive children often have poor concentration and require very little sleep.
